1. Nespresso Vertuo Plus

The Nespresso Vertuo Plus will be the best Nespresso machine for you if a coffee lover who is seeking consistency and efficiency. The Vertuo Plus is easy to operate and has a minimalistic design that can be incorporated with any kitchen design. Place a capsule in the machine and press on brew to enjoy your beverage. The machine adjusts the brewing parameters automatically to maximize extraction in accordance with the barcode on the capsule. This is an important selling point for Nespresso Vertuo, as you do not have to be concerned about adjusting temperatures or pressures for different types. However, it does limit your options to only Nespresso pods and doesn't include an integrated milk frother.

The Vertuo Plus uses Nespresso's Centrifusion technology to produce a rich, smooth crema. The machine rotates at up to 7000 rpm in order to extract the full range of aromas and flavors in each capsule. It also heats and dispensates water simultaneously, allowing you to make American drip coffee or espresso.

The Vertuo Plus is a lot less expensive than the Creatista Pro, which makes it ideal for those who are looking for a basic upgrade to their existing Nespresso experience. The Vertuo Plus has smaller water tanks, which are 40 ounces compared to premium model's 60 ounces. If you plan to make large drinks or to share it with guests and guests, then the premium model could be a better choice.

2. Barista Express Impress

Breville's Barista Express Impress is an attractive machine that has a stylish design and practical features. Its smart dosing system and assisted tamping help beginners simplify the process by automating certain parts of it, making it easier for anyone to create a decent espresso. It can also make small adjustments to the temperature of water, which more experienced baristas will appreciate as even a couple of degrees can affect the flavor of the coffee.

The machine has a high-quality conical burr grinder which offers 25 grind settings to suit any coffee type. It also comes with a stainless-steel milk jug and two-cup single- and double-wall filtering baskets, so you can decide how many shots to make at a time. You can also use the frothing arms to make micro-foam for cappuccinos and lattes.

The interface of the espresso machine is easy to navigate and clearly explains each step. We also liked the fact that the machine is constructed of durable plastic and doesn't use many. It's not cheap, but it's a high-quality machine that has many features that will last many years. It also comes with a great warranty that covers mechanical issues for a year after the date of purchase. This is pretty impressive for an espresso machine that costs this much. It's definitely worth the investment in case you're looking to test your hand at making espresso regularly.

3. Gaggia Classic

Gaggia's Classic made its debut in 1991. It quickly gained a following of cult status due to its minimalist style and - of course - ability to create a delicious espresso. More than three decades later, it's back stronger than ever with the new Classic Pro. Although the Classic Pro isn't as advanced than other entry-level machines, it is still capable of producing espresso that is cafe-quality with the high-end portafilter and group. As only a single boiler unit, you will not be able prepare and steam at the same time. You'll have to wait a few minutes before brewing an espresso.

The Classic Pro has a sleek industrial look and feel that is elegant and sturdy in your hands. It has simple switches to turn it on/off and to brew/steam with indicators. The frame and switches are more durable than the Classic giving this machine a authentic premium feel.

In terms of accessories the Classic Pro doesn't come with many, but the standard commercial portafilter 58 millimeter and the tamper made from plastic are a nice touch. A three-way solenoid is a nice addition. It reduces pressure fluctuations and helps to eliminate the sloppy espresso pucks that cheaper machines are unable to accomplish. Gaggia has also included an elegant steam wand that is great at making milk frothy to create the art of latte.
